When E-Switch mode was enabled, the NIC egress flows was implicitly appended with source vport to match on. If the metadata register C0 was used to maintain the source vport, it was initialized to zero on packet steering engine entry, the flow could be hit only if source vport was zero, the register C0 of the packet was not correct to match in the TX side, this caused egress flow misses.
This patch: - removes the implicit source vport match for NIC egress flow. - rejects the NIC egress flows on the representor ports at validation. - allows the internal NIC egress flows containing the TX_QUEUE items in order to not impact hairpins.
